Capping Book Banned
r.V.Z. Press Association)
WHANGAREI, March 22.
The Kaikohe Borough Council has prohibited the street sales of Auckland University capping books in Kaikohe. At a meeting of the council last night a request by the Auckland University Students’ Association to sell books in Kaikohe between April 29 and May 6 was refused. Cr. O. J. Toplis said the books were not funny but “crude, even terrible.”
